2012-02-28 83 views
58

Intento resolver este problema varias veces y darme por vencido. Ahora, cuando lo volví a encontrar, decidí pedir ayuda.HighCharts Hide Series Nombre de la leyenda

Tengo este código para mi Leyenda:

legend: 
{ 
    layout: 'vertical', 
    align: 'right', 
    verticalAlign: 'top', 
    x: -10, 
    y: 100, 
    borderWidth: 0, 



    labelFormatter: function() 
    { 
     if(this.name!='Series 1') 
     { 
      return this.name; 
     } 
     else 
     { 
      return 'Legend'; 
     } 
    } 
} 

Si cambio el regreso de 'Leyenda' a '' el texto no se muestra, pero todavía hay un 'guión' en la parte superior de la leyenda . Si no uso la función de formateador de etiqueta, tengo 'Serie 1' + 'guión' como una primera fila en mi leyenda. ¿Cómo esconderlos?

Por favor, tenga en cuenta mi versión es: Highcharts-2.0.5

Ésta es una vista sencilla de mi leyenda y el guión Quiero quitar:

Sample Image http://img72.imageshack.us/img72/8305/45167805.png

Respuesta

147

si no desea mostrar los nombres de las series en la leyenda, puede desactivarlo configurando showInLegend: false. ex:

series: [{ 
    showInLegend: false,    
     name: "<b><?php echo $title; ?></b>", 
     data: [<?php echo $yaxis; ?>], 
}] 

Aquí tienes otras opciones.

+0

usando "showInLegend: false" realmente solucionó mi problema. Me pregunto si esta opción solo oculta el nombre de la serie, porque la leyenda aún muestra los datos (como yo quiero). – gotqn

+0

Suponiendo que estas opciones estén habilitadas, dará una vista clara, por lo que están habilitadas de forma predeterminada. si no los necesitan, quítenlo. eso es lo que has hecho aquí. – VKGS

4

Parece que HighChart 2.2. 0 ha resuelto este problema. Lo probé here con el mismo código que tiene, y la primera serie está oculta ahora. ¿Podrías probarlo con HighChart 2.2.0?

1

Reemplazar retorno 'Leyenda' de retorno ''

10

Conjunto showInLegend a falso.

series: [{ 
      showInLegend: false, 
      name: 'Series', 
      data: value     
     }] 
Cuestiones relacionadas